Output e6103068b209a2c2b5d3cb65de5dcdb3e54dcdce78e998a837f1df63dbb3f217:3

value
18821800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3fdeb9eca25197bb4f9d259a9525fb4fa3b5e14 OP_EQUAL
address
3KZKseaoonccyDd9KS4Z2f3U96h5paFK4W
transaction
e6103068b209a2c2b5d3cb65de5dcdb3e54dcdce78e998a837f1df63dbb3f217
confirmations
250540
spent
true